WebJan 23, 2024 · Narrative viewpoint and sentence structures are two of those. They are hard to write about in terms of the arrangement of ideas. Best avoided unless you are absolutely sure about how you can use these to writer about how the ideas are arranged. It’s the quality of comment that is the important thing.

We’ve listed out our top writing tips to help you with the … how do you add a hyperlink in wordWebSentence structures Varied types of sentences, e.g. simple, compound and complex. Comment on how sentence structures affect the fluency of the text, e.g. a sudden short sentence could revel shocking information.
